首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
组件化
订阅
l01
更多收藏集
微信扫码分享
微信
新浪微博
QQ
20篇文章 · 0订阅
[极致用户体验] 网页里的「返回」应该用 history.back 还是 push ?
只要网页里有「返回」都会遇到这个问题。其实,你用back或push实现,都有问题。本文提供了完美解决方案,实现了逻辑正确的「返回」按钮,而且没有剥夺用户使用「原生返回」的权利。
一文读懂全球化系统中的日期时间处理问题
全球化的产品中,如果时间的处理没有遵循统一的标准,会让整个系统充斥着难以理解和维护的时间转换。各种接口的对接文档,都不得不明确说明「这个接口的时间是什么时区的?需要如何处理?」
虚拟列表,我真的会了!!!
如果我想要在网页中放大量的列表项,纯渲染的话,对于浏览器性能将会是个极大的挑战,会造成滚动卡顿,整体体验非常不好。虚拟列表思想的出现,就是为了帮助我们解决长列表问题的,下面让我们来一起了解下吧!
一个支持百万量级的vue3无限滚动组件
`vue3-infinite-list`是一个针对vue3的短小精悍的无限滚动组件,它体积非常小、零依赖gzip只有 3kb。
前端领域的 “干净架构”
它是一种非常方便的方案,可以帮助你解耦你的代码。让层、模块和服务尽量独立。不仅可以独立发布、部署,还可以让你从一个项目迁移另一个项目的时候也更加容易。
用了这个设计模式,我优化了50%表单校验代码
假设我们正在编写一个注册页面,在点击注册按钮之时,有一些校验逻辑。我们通常会使用一些 if 语句来覆盖所有规则,但这样使得代码臃肿且无法复用。能否使用一种设计模式来解决上述问题呢?
浅谈:为啥vue和react都选择了Hooks🏂?
什么是Hooks?它的优点在哪?为啥vue和react都认为它是未来?小春我想和大家简单聊一聊关于Hooks的来龙去脉。
10个有用的自定义钩子vue.js
Vue 是我使用的第一个 JS 框架。可以说,Vue 是我进入JavaScript世界的第一道门之一。目前,Vue 仍然是一个很棒的框架。随着 composition API 的出现,Vue 只会有更
Grid网格布局
一、介绍 Grid网格布局,是一个基于栅格的二维布局系统,相对于flex一维布局,Grid布局的功能更为强大 Grid布局可以将网页分成一个个网格,可以任意组合不同的网格,做出各种各样的布局
React Hooks性能优化
memo、useMemo、useCallback的使用 memo 定义:React.memo 仅检查 props 变更。 当props变更时,及渲染组件(不管子组件是否依赖props)。